4. Insights: Key Developments in AI Agents for DApps

Coral Protocol offers unique solutions that set it apart in the realm of AI agent communication. One of its most distinct features is its decentralized communication architecture, which ensures secure dialogue among agents without the need for a central authority. This capability is akin to how modern web browsers can communicate efficiently with each other using HTTP protocols, but adapted for the dynamic needs of decentralized AI applications.
HiTech AI, a company leveraging Coral Protocol, has reported improvements in system latency and efficiency with this synergy, transforming how tasks are allocated and completed in a distributed setting. By enabling more robust and flexible communication pathways, Coral Protocol surpasses traditional centralized models that often stifle innovation through bottleneck issues.
